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E A novel tire building drum is provided herein, which is a cylindrical tire building drum. Such drum includes a non-inflatable, non-collapsible, rigid, non-reactive, vulcanization-resistant, unreinforced, synthetic thermo- plastic material shell. The shell is of the same diameter between its two axial ends. It is also provided with a smooth surface between its two axial ends. The shell has a particular specified uniform cylindrical shape, and a central, axially-longitudinally-extending core of a non- circular cross-section. The core is specially adapted for mounting the cylindrical tire building drum on a rotatable, axially-longitudinally-extending shaft of a conventional tire building machine. The core has a plurality of integral, fixed-length, rigid, non-movable, radially- outwardly-projecting, axially-longitudinally-extending ribs. The ribs each project radially between the core and the shell, each such rib being connected to its associated face of the central core and to the shell of the cylindri- cal tire building drum at a thickened area of greater cross-sectional area than the cross-sectional area of the other portions of each rib at both side faces of each rib, thereby to provide rugged reinforcement areas. The cylind- rical tire building drum has an axially-longitudinally- extending length which varies from 1 foot to 20 feet.
